"the model’s gut-check survives fine-tuning, but the decoder stops listening to it." very fascinating

The paper’s core finding is simple and a little surprising: when you fine-tune an LLM and it starts answering confidently even when it shouldn’t, the model hasn’t “forgotten” how to be cautious. The internal features that separate answerable from unanswerable prompts are still…
